Thunder: Autonomous Rotorcraft for Deep-Strike Missions

Image Credit: Skynet

Thunder is a Group 5 autonomous attack rotorcraft designed to carry heavy payloads over long distances at high speed into heavily defended areas.

Its combination of autonomy, range, and strike capacity signals a major shift in how militaries can project force deeper into contested battlespace.

Key Points in Video:

  • Classified as a Group 5 aircraft, placing it in the largest unmanned system category with substantial size, endurance, and mission capacity.
  • Built for the deepest parts of the battlefield, where air defenses and operational risk are typically highest.
  • Combines payload, speed, and range in a single platform to support high-impact attack missions without relying on a pilot onboard.
  • Positions autonomy as a frontline combat capability, not just a support or surveillance function.
